When attracted during winter, many traditional drapes can decrease warm loss from a cozy space as much as 10% and boost the thermal convenience of the home. As a result, in wintertime, you must shut all draperies during the night, in addition to drapes that don't receive sunshine during the day. To decrease heat loss, drapes should be hung as close to windows as possible and drop onto a windowsill or floor.
Secure the drapery at both sides and overlap it in the. You can utilize Velcro or magnetic tape to affix drapes to the wall surface at the sides and base. Taking these actions will better lower warmth loss. Two drapes hung together will develop a tighter air space than simply one drapery.

Home window movies (put on the glazing surface) help obstruct versus solar heat gain and secure versus glow and ultraviolet direct exposure. window treatments. They are best made use of in environments with long cooling periods, since they also block the sun's warmth in the wintertime. They can be helpful for property owners that do not wish to obstruct views with other window treatments, however that have concerns with glow and solar heat gain
You might additionally select options such as tints, UV blockers, or thicker movies that supply safety and security. Window films are rated by the National Fenestration Rating Council (NFRC), which also developed home window labeling and ratings for customers.

The efficiency of these reflective films relies on: Size of window glazing area Window alignment Climate Structure positioning Whether the home window has indoor insulation.
Much more lately, there are solar control films that have an even more neutral look and work at blocking near IR solar radiation in the summertime. East- and west-facing windows, since of their greater potential for warmth gain, can profit more from these movies. North-facing home windows won't take advantage of them, and south-facing windows might benefit rather, yet the advantage could be balanced out by the reduction of heat from the winter sunlight.
